Madison County Leader, New York, Thursday, 28 October 1915
Death of Mrs. William Bassett
Addie, wife of William Bassett, died Thursday at her home just south of Morrisville and following an illness of several weeks. Mrs. Bassett was born in the town of Madison 46 years ago, being a daughter of the late Alonzo Wilber, an old-time resident of that town, and who died a few weeks since. She had lived in this vicinity for more than 25 years. Mrs. Bassett, although of a quiet and retiring temperament, was possessed of those qualities of heart and mind looked for in the consistent Christian. She will be missed in her neighborhood. Besides her husband, she is survived by a son, Lynn Bassett of Pratts, one brother, Albert Wilber of Oriskany Falls, and three sisters: Miss Nellie Wilber of Oriskany Falls, Mrs. Janette Mayall of Stony-Point-on-the Hudson, and Laura, a married sister residing at Richland. The funeral was held on Monday afternoon, Rev. John R. Willis, pastor of the Morrisville Congregational church, officiating. Burial was made in the Cedar street cemetery.
1900 Federal Census of Eaton, Madison County, New York (6 Jun 1900)
William Bassett - 39 - M - Jul 1860 - NY-EN-EN - Head - Farmer Dairy Farm
Ada - 32 - F - Oct 1867 - NY-NY-NY - Wife
Lynn - 11 - M - Nov 1888 - NY-NY-NY - Son
(Married 14 years, 2 children, 1 living)
1910 Federal Census of Morrisville, Eaton, Madison County, New York (25 Apr 1910)
William B. Bassett - 48 - M - NY-EN-EN - Head - Farmer Dairy Farm
Ada M. - 40 - F - NY-NY-NY - Wife
(Married 24 years, 1 child, 1 living)
